ACYLOTROPIC TAUTOMERISM. XIII. MOLECULAR STRUCTURE AND REACTION PATH OF INTRAMOLECULAR TRANSARYLATION IN O-(NITROPHENYL)DERIVATIVES OF TROPOLONES
Furmanova, N. G.,Olekhnovich, L. P.,Minkin, V. I.,Struchkov, Yu. T.,Kompan, O. E.,et al.
, p. 416 - 424 (2007/10/02)
The ring-chain equilibrium and kinetics in O,O'-transfer of polynitroaryl groups in the series of O-(nitrophenyl) derivatives of tropolone and its analogs were studied by UV and NMR spectroscopy.The crystal structure and molecular structure of O-(2',4',6'-trinitrophenyl)tropolone, S-(2',4',6'-trinitrophenyl)thiotropone, and O-(2'-nitro-4'-trifluoromethylsulfonylphenyl)-3,5,7-trimethyltropolone were determined by x-ray crystallographic analysis.Comparison of the geometric characteristics of these compounds and of the previously investigated O-(2',4',6'-trinitrophenyl)and O-(2',6'-dinitrophenyl) derivatives of 3,5,7-trimethyltropolone revealed an intramolecular transarylation path.
